About This Route
Both Cherokee Sound Beach and Guana Cay Beach are located in the Central Abacos. This passage connects Cherokee Sound Beach, known for its a timeless loyalist village beach anchored by the bahamas' longest wooden dock, perfect for wading and sunsets., with Guana Cay Beach, where you can experience five and a half miles of pristine atlantic sand, legendary beach bars, and sea turtles nesting in summer.. The Sea of Abaco provides protected waters for most of this route, making it a comfortable sail in typical conditions.
Important: Distances are approximate direct (straight-line) measurements for trip-planning only. Actual sailing routes follow channels and marked passages and will be longer. Do not use for navigation.
